About the workshop

It is important that employment contracts start and end fairly and responsibly. Every HR professional and business owner must understand obligations and rights of both parties during separation.

Learn how you should bring employment contracts to a close in line with the legislation including the fair and responsible way to manage retrenchment in the unfortunate event that you have to retrench employees as a last resort. This half-day workshop will focus on the salient features of dismissal and retrenchment together with the sharing of best practices involved.

About the Trainer

Lau Weng Hong

Principal Mediator

Tripartite Alliance for Dispute Management

Lau Weng Hong was with the Ministry of Manpower for more than 35 years and during this period, he held various appointments including Deputy Director (Labour Relations), Senior Consultant & Conciliator (IR), Head of Tripartite Promotion Unit and Assistant Commissioner for Labour at the former Labour Court dealing with employment disputes under the Employment Act. Over the last 20 years, he was involved in many tripartite committees including the Tripartite Taskforce on Wage Restructuring and Tripartite Committee on Employability of Older Workers. With his extensive experience on labour relations and industrial relations, he is able to advise employers and trade unions on the application of various employment laws, tripartite advisories and guidelines.
